About Greenwich 2065

The size of Greenwich is approximately 1.6 square kilometres. It has 17 parks covering nearly 20.3% of total area. The population of Greenwich in 2011 was 5,178 people. By 2016 the population was 5,614 showing a population growth of 8.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Greenwich is 30-39 years. Households in Greenwich are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Greenwich work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 66.8% of the homes in Greenwich were owner-occupied compared with 65.8% in 2016.

Greenwich has 2,790 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Greenwich have seen a 81.98%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 5.42% increase. As at 31 August 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Greenwich is $4,343,907 while the median value for Units is $931,169.
  • Houses have a median rent of $1,250 while Units have a median rent of $700.
